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 509154 - sys-apps/smartmontools depends on virtual/mailx
Summary: sys-apps/smartmontools depends on virtual/mailx
Status: RESOLVED FIXED
Alias: None
Product: Gentoo/Alt
Classification: Unclassified
Component: FreeBSD (show other bugs)
Hardware: All FreeBSD
: Normal normal (vote)
Assignee: Gentoo/BSD Team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2014-04-30 09:51 UTC by Dmitri Bogomolov
Modified: 2014-05-13 06:37 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
patch for sys-apps/smartmontools-6.2 (smartmontools-6.2.ebuild.patch,397 bytes, patch)
2014-04-30 10:02 UTC, Dmitri Bogomolov
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Dmitri Bogomolov 2014-04-30 09:51:00 UTC
It seems that sys-freebsd/freebsd-ubin provides mailx functionality in fbsd.

Reproducible: Always

Steps to Reproduce:
1. emerge -pv smartmontools::gentoo

Actual Results:  
These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ild  N    *] mail-client/mailx-support-20060102-r1  9 kB
[ebuild  N     ] net-libs/liblockfile-1.09  32 kB
[ebuild  N    *] mail-client/mailx-8.1.2.20050715-r6  129 kB
[ebuild  N    *] virtual/mailx-0  0 kB
[ebuild   R    ] sys-apps/smartmontools-6.2::gentoo [6.2::local] USE="(-caps) -minimal (-selinux) -static" 0 kB

Total: 5 packages (4 new, 1 reinstall), Size of downloads: 169 kB

The following keyword changes are necessary to proceed:
 (see "package.accept_keywords" in the portage(5) man page for more details)
# required by virtual/mailx-0
# required by sys-apps/smartmontools-6.2[-minimal]
# required by smartmontools::gentoo (argument)
=mail-client/mailx-8.1.2.20050715-r6 **
# required by sys-apps/smartmontools-6.2[-minimal]
# required by smartmontools::gentoo (argument)
=virtual/mailx-0 **
# required by mail-client/mailx-8.1.2.20050715-r6
# required by virtual/mailx-0
# required by sys-apps/smartmontools-6.2[-minimal]
# required by smartmontools::gentoo (argument)
=mail-client/mailx-support-20060102-r1 **

NOTE: The --autounmask-keep-masks option will prevent emerge
      from creating package.unmask or ** keyword changes.

Expected Results:  
These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ild     U  ] sys-apps/smartmontools-6.2::gentoo [6.0::local] USE="(-caps) -minimal (-selinux) -static" 0 kB

Total: 1 package (1 upgrade), Size of downloads: 0 kB
Comment 1 Dmitri Bogomolov 2014-04-30 10:02:03 UTC
Created attachment 376060 [details, diff]
patch for sys-apps/smartmontools-6.2
Comment 2 Naohiro Aota gentoo-dev 2014-05-06 04:17:35 UTC
Should be fixed by modifying virtual/mailx instead.
Comment 3 Naohiro Aota gentoo-dev 2014-05-13 06:37:36 UTC
Added sys-freebsd/freebsd-ubin as virtual/mailx provider.